  VISITING THE PRESERVE
The Cache Creek Nature Preserve is open from 7AM to 4PM Monday through Friday, and on our monthly Open Day held on the third Saturday of the month from 9AM-2PM. For general visitors, please check-in at the office when you arrive to receive a trail guide. For large groups, or to request a guided tour or other program please call (530) 661-1070.

HOW TO FIND US
  CCNP is west of Woodland, and north of Winters and Davis. Nearby highways include Interstates 5, 505 and 80, and Highway 16.

FACILITIES
Picnic tables and benches are available for your picnic enjoyment. A couple of porta-potties and a wash station are available. Bring extra water since there is no concession stand.

A small classroom with tables and chairs is available for educational workshops. It is ideal for about 15 adults.
